48 lines
1.0 KiB
Markdown
48 lines
1.0 KiB
Markdown
## Intergalactic
|
|
|
|
Intergalactic is a client-side gateway to the IPFS distributed web. After the
|
|
initial page load and bootstrapping, it pulls content from IPFS peers entirely
|
|
in your browser.
|
|
|
|
## Motivation
|
|
|
|
Intergalactic brings the distributed web to anyone with a web browser. This
|
|
allows web developers and content producers to publish their content through
|
|
IPFS, while still allowing users to consume it. All without having to download
|
|
any software or go through a centralized gateway.
|
|
|
|
## Installation
|
|
|
|
```shell
|
|
npm install
|
|
```
|
|
|
|
TODO
|
|
|
|
## Usage
|
|
|
|
### Development
|
|
|
|
First, run the following from your copy of Intergalactic's source code:
|
|
|
|
```shell
|
|
node server.js
|
|
```
|
|
|
|
Then, enter a URL like `http://localhost:3000/ipfs/<hash>` into your web
|
|
browser, where `<hash>` is the IPFS hash of some content on the network.
|
|
|
|
If the corresponding content is loadable, it will load and render in your
|
|
browser.
|
|
|
|
|
|
### Production
|
|
|
|
TODO
|
|
|
|
|
|
### Compatibility
|
|
|
|
So far, this is only tested in Firefox 57 on Linux. If you have success or
|
|
issues on other browsers, please let me know.
|